1、Android開發(fā)環(huán)境搭建:Android介紹,Android開發(fā)環(huán)境搭建,先進個Android應用程序,Android應用程序目錄結(jié)構(gòu)。
創(chuàng)新互聯(lián)專注于太原網(wǎng)站建設服務及定制,我們擁有豐富的企業(yè)做網(wǎng)站經(jīng)驗。 熱誠為您提供太原營銷型網(wǎng)站建設,太原網(wǎng)站制作、太原網(wǎng)頁設計、太原網(wǎng)站官網(wǎng)定制、重慶小程序開發(fā)服務,打造太原網(wǎng)絡公司原創(chuàng)品牌,更為您提供太原網(wǎng)站排名全網(wǎng)營銷落地服務。
2、android以java為基礎的,所以前提要學好Java基礎知識,比如基本類型、集合等。android api,學習基本的Activity、service、intent等基本的知識,可以開發(fā)一些界面。計算機網(wǎng)絡基本知識。
3、一:JavaSE編程 Java是一種面向?qū)ο蟮拈_發(fā)語言,Android操作系統(tǒng)的應用層使用Java語言來開發(fā),所以要想進行Android開發(fā)必須有良好的Java基礎。
4、安卓手機軟件開發(fā)學習基礎條件 由于安卓應用開發(fā)語言用的是Java語言,所以學習安卓手機軟件開發(fā)首先要具備一定的java語言基礎。
5、最好先熟悉一門編程語言,現(xiàn)在計算機專業(yè)一般都會開設C語言課程,android入門學習必須要有C語言基礎課程。
6、安卓手機開發(fā)要學什么?如果你沒有任何的計算機基礎,但是將來想從事安卓手機開發(fā)的工作,可以來北大青鳥學校。
第一就是技術(shù)要扎實 在從事這個行業(yè)之前我參加過Android軟件開發(fā)培訓,在北大青鳥學習了一段時間,雖然之前沒有接觸過,但是在這一段時間內(nèi)學會了很多的知識。
具備手機游戲或客戶端游戲開發(fā)經(jīng)驗者優(yōu)先; 熟悉ios或android系統(tǒng)原理,熟悉移動終端環(huán)境特性及相關(guān)解決方案者優(yōu)先。
表現(xiàn)在:低收入,工作時間長,這種職位只能強化職業(yè)者在單方面的技術(shù)領域技能。如果按照從業(yè)者們將自己自嘲為碼農(nóng)的表現(xiàn),那么碼農(nóng)的程序員分級中理應只屬于初級程序員,是屬于依靠復制粘貼將各類代碼鏈接的IT從業(yè)者。
做程序員需要的學歷沒有一定的要求,大專和大本的很多。從事程序員行業(yè)需要的職業(yè)技能如下:專業(yè)技能。
這是市場方面的碎裂化問題,而且,有時候它也會讓設備型號變得紛亂繁雜。這就意味著要建立更多的版本、協(xié)議等等,這些都會是令你頭痛的工作。與此相反的是,iOS和Windows手機就沒有這么多繁雜的工作要做。
Java基礎語法 設計模式:由于在Android系統(tǒng)的框架層當中,使用了大量的設計模式,如果沒有這個方面的知識,對于Android的理解就會大打折扣。
錯誤的團隊如果你不幸選擇了一個錯誤的團隊,經(jīng)常遇到問題是不可避免的。很多時候并不是任何人的錯,但是團隊里面的人會因為各種問題感到不開心,或者對瑣碎的事情感覺到厭惡,這些都是影響團隊氛圍的關(guān)鍵點。
編寫高質(zhì)量的單元測試 單元測試是容易執(zhí)行,且對提高代碼質(zhì)量見效快的方法之一還。但還是有很多公司對單元測試重視不夠,包括一些大的互聯(lián)網(wǎng)公司,不寫或者隨便寫寫。
android以java為基礎的,所以前提要學好Java基礎知識,比如基本類型、集合等。android api,學習基本的Activity、service、intent等基本的知識,可以開發(fā)一些界面。計算機網(wǎng)絡基本知識。
)使用xml文件布局 使用xml首先對于界面進行布局,然后在Activity里面進行引用是最常見的應用軟件開發(fā)技術(shù),這種方式使用的最大,需要學習的內(nèi)容也最多。
熟練的Linux驅(qū)動開發(fā),精通Linux內(nèi)核結(jié)構(gòu)。掌握Android移植,比如常見的TIOMAP、QualcommMSM的硬件移植 邁向頂級,發(fā)現(xiàn)Android系統(tǒng)中的0day漏洞,可以輕松的找出Root系統(tǒng)的10種方法,幫助Google改進Android操作系統(tǒng)。
安卓是當前IT行業(yè)中最具創(chuàng)造力、前瞻性、延續(xù)性和實現(xiàn)能力能力的語言。安卓開發(fā)學習也成為新潮流。安卓手機開發(fā)要學什么?最好先熟悉一門編程語言。